this is Unofficial LineageOS LG G3 Dual Sim Variant + Added support for D-859.

Tested on D858HK but you can try it on other variant and hopefully it will work. Good Luck

It’s still stable build however we will make it more smoother and faster with weekly updates.

New Rebase Builds With Android 7.1.2 Download :laugh:

https://www.androidfilehost.com/?w=files&flid=154532

Installation Guides
1- 4 Wipes (Caches, Dalvik,System & Data)
2- Flash ROM
3- Flash Gapps of your choice
4- Reboot and enjoy
